Miguel Torres


Viña Miguel Torres is a winery that opened in 1979 in Curicó. It was founded by the renowned Spanish winemaking family Torres as the first foreign winery opened in Chile. The family chose this part of the world to expand their business due to the favorable climatic conditions for growing grapevines. Over the past thirty years, the winery has established itself as one of the leaders in the production of high-quality wines. The current owner and part of the fifth generation of the Torres family, Miguel Torres Maczassek, focuses on expanding exports as well as producing organic wines, which have their own special line at the winery called Santa Digna.
